Most failed automation projects are not model failures. They are process failures exposed by software: unclear ownership, inconsistent records, undocumented exceptions, and workflows that only work because one person knows where the bodies are buried.
Templates cannot carry hidden business logic
Off-the-shelf tools are useful for simple handoffs, but they struggle when the next step depends on account history, permissions, contract terms, or judgment. The gap between custom AI automation vs off-the-shelf software becomes obvious when a workflow must interpret context, call several systems, and leave an audit trail.
- Ambiguous triggers: A workflow cannot act consistently when the event that starts it has multiple meanings.
- Fragmented records: Decisions degrade when customer, product, and financial data live in conflicting places.
- Unowned exceptions: Edge cases accumulate when nobody is assigned to resolve and improve them.
- Invisible failures: A task that stops quietly can create more work than the manual process it replaced.
Build the process map before the agent
Map the current path from trigger to outcome, including inputs, systems, approvals, exceptions, and the person who owns the final result. This is where business process automation becomes practical: the team can remove duplicate steps before asking software to reproduce them.

Reliable automation has a narrow job, a defined operating boundary, and observable outcomes. It does not pretend every decision is identical, and it does not conceal uncertainty behind polished language.
Agents need constrained access and explicit actions
Useful agents retrieve approved context, apply a limited set of rules, take permitted actions, and record what happened. Teams designing custom AI agents should define which tools an agent may use, what data it can see, and which actions require approval.
Secure deployment matters because an agent can compound the impact of bad instructions or overly broad access. Guidance on agentic AI systems is a useful reminder that permissions, logging, and threat modelling belong in the design, not in a later cleanup sprint.
Human review is a control, not a confession
Human-in-the-loop checkpoints belong at decisions involving money, legal commitments, sensitive customer communication, or uncertain data. Reviewing generative AI outputs with people from different functions can surface bias, factual errors, and operational assumptions before they reach customers.
An AI workflow only creates leverage when it works from the same operational truth as the people using it. Copying records into a separate prompt, spreadsheet, or dashboard creates lag and makes the automation less trustworthy at exactly the moment speed matters.
Use source-of-truth data and durable interfaces
Start with the systems where work already happens, such as the CRM, support platform, billing tool, project tracker, or internal database. Thoughtful AI systems integration uses documented interfaces, validates incoming data, and returns results to the right record so a teammate can understand the decision without searching across tabs.
For startup operations, a good first workflow often turns a repeatable intake event into a prepared action: classify the request, collect required context, draft a response or task, and route uncertainty to an owner. That pattern lets teams use smart AI agents for bounded tasks without giving a system uncontrolled authority.
Architect for change instead of a one-time launch
Business rules change, vendors alter APIs, and teams redefine what good output means. Use separate workflow logic, data access, prompt instructions, and monitoring so each can be updated without breaking the entire operation; privacy-protective design also favors anonymized or de-identified data where personal information is not required for the purpose.
Responsible AI principles reinforce a basic operational rule: accountability for decisions remains with the organization, even when an automated system supports the decision.
Start with one workflow that is frequent, painful, and measurable, then prove that it reduces handoffs without lowering quality. The right scope is not the biggest process on the roadmap; it is the one where the team can define a clear before-and-after outcome and learn quickly from exceptions.
Choose a workflow with a real operational signal
Good candidates have a known trigger, available source data, and a bounded result, such as qualifying an inbound request, assembling account context, routing support issues, or preparing a follow-up task. Avoid automating a process that is still changing weekly, because the build will encode confusion rather than remove it.
Define acceptance criteria in operational language: what information must be present, which outcome is acceptable, when a person must intervene, and where the workflow records its action. Those rules turn vague AI implementation for startup operations into a system that can be tested against real work.

Do not confuse rapid prototyping with a finished operational system. Production-ready work includes access controls, error handling, review queues, logging, maintenance ownership, and a plan for improving the workflow as new cases appear.
AI automation earns its place when it eliminates real coordination work while making decisions easier to inspect, correct, and improve. The strongest systems connect to the tools a startup already trusts, limit automated authority, and make exceptions visible to the people responsible for outcomes. Build one durable workflow first, then expand from evidence rather than hype.
